Bradley,Maghera Parish,Glen Chapel
« on: Monday 26 September 11 18:18 BST (UK) »
Hi,

Does any one have any further information on the above?
Sara Jane Bradley was baptised in the parish of Maghera Co.Derry on 21at August 1842
by Rev. John Dempsey.
Her parents were Francis Bradley and Nancy O'Neill.Sponsors,Patrick Kearney and Jane Bradley.

Hi,

I have located a Francis Bradley married to Nancy O'Neill whose daughter,Sara Jane Bradley was baptised in the Parish/District of Maghera on 21st August 1842. Sponsors Patrick Kearney and Jane Bradley.
The priest was Rev.John Dempsey who was at Glen Chapel at that time,1841 - 1847.
Does any one have any records that might show any other siblings of Sara Jane or related information.
